По вашему запросу ничего не найдено :(
Убедитесь, что запрос написан правильно, или посмотрите другие
наши статьи:
Интеграция Asterisk и CUCM позволяет по протоколу SIP позволяет объединить несколько телефонных пулов, или, например, использовать Asterisk в роли IVR (голосового меню). Как правильно объединить Asterisk и Cisco Unified Communications Manager через SIP – транк расскажем в статье
Настройка CUCM
Перейдем к настройке Cisco UCM. Для создания нового SIP – транка в раздел Device -> Trunk и нажмите на кнопку Add New. Мы создаем SIP – транк, поэтому, укажите поле Trunk Type и Device Protocol на SIP, как указано на скриншоте ниже:
После указания настроек нажмите Next. В появившемся окне указываем следующие опции:
Device Name - имя для создаваемого SIP – транка. Обязательное поле
Description - описание создаваемого подключения.
Device Pool - выберите девайс пул для SIP – транка. Необходимо, чтобы он совпадал с устройствами, которые будут маршрутизироваться через этот транк. Обязательное поле
Листаем вниз, и находим раздел под названием Inbound Calls и выставляем следующую опцию:
Calling Search Space - имя CSS для SIP - транка. Должно совпадать с маршрутизируемыми устройствами.
Последний шаг настроек находится в разделе SIP Information в пункте Destination, тут настраиваем следующие опции:
Destination Address - Введите IP – адрес вашего Asterisk. Обратите внимание, что по умолчанию порт назначения 5060. Если ваш сервер Asterisk слушает SIP на другом порту, то укажите его в поле Destination Port. Обязательное поле
SIP Trunk Security Profile - профиль безопасности для SIP - транка. Укажите в данном поле Non Secure SIP Trunk Profile. Обязательное поле
Rerouting Calling Search Space - укажите CSS, который указали ранее в разделе настроек Inbound Calls.
Out-Of-Dialog Refer Calling Search Space - аналогично указанному ранее пункту.
SUBSCRIBE Calling Search Space - так же укажите CSS.
SIP Profile - SIP профиль. В данном поле указывается Standard SIP Profile
По окончанию настроек нажмите Save. Маршрутизацию в SIP – транк можно осуществлять с помощью шаблонов, которые настраиваются в настройках Route Pattern.
Настройка со стороны Asterisk
Все настройки SIP – транка на стороне Asterisk будем выполнять с помощью графической оболочки FreePBX 13. Для настройки транка перейдем в раздел Connectivity -> Trunks. Нажмите на + Add Trunk, чтобы создать новый SIP – транк.
Во вкладке General, укажите имя для создаваемого транка. Далее, переходим во вкладку pjsip Settings. Так как в рамках настройки SIP – транка между Asterisk и CUCM мы не используем регистрацию по логину/паролю, то отмечаем следующие опции:
Authentication - выставьте None. Как сказано раньше, мы не используем аутентификацию по логину и паролю.
Registration - выставьте None.
SIP Server - укажите IP – адрес Cisco UCM.
Context - укажите контекст from-internal
Перейдите во вкладку Advanced:
Qualify Frequency - выставьте 60. Интервал в секундах, через который будут отправляться Keep – Alive сообщения для проверки состояния транка.
From Domain - укажите IP – адрес вашего CUCM
Нажмите Submit и затем Apply Config. После этого необходимо настроить маршрутизацию для этого транка. Как это сделать, вы можете прочитать в статье по ссылке ниже:
Маршрутизация вызовов FreePBX
IT-отрасль постоянно развивается и трансформируется, а с ней растет и спрос на специалистов. От веб-разработчиков до аналитиков данных, от продакт менеджеров до дизайнеров — для каждой профессиональной сферы есть площадки и ресурсы с вакансиями. В этой статье мы рассмотрим основные платформы: вы узнаете, где лучше искать работу, на каких площадках можно встретить вакансию мечты и как вам помогут соцсети и telegram-каналы.
Где искать работу: сайты с вакансиями
Чтобы устроиться на хорошую работу, важно уметь выделиться из толпы и привлечь внимание будущего работодателя. Для этого лучше всего подойдет размещение своего резюме на сайте с вакансиями. Рассказываем про топ-7 российских ресурсов, на которых можно находить вакансии в своей сфере.
HeadHunter
Любой человек, когда-либо искавший работу, знаком с этой площадкой — и все же не упомянуть ее в контексте поиска работы в IT было бы непростительно. На HeadHunter всегда есть огромная выборка вакансий для любых IT-направлений, поэтому обратите внимание на этот ресурс при поиске работы.
Хабр Карьера
Где искать работу кроме HH? Здесь, в экосистеме Хабра — платформы, собравшей вокруг себя мощное IT-комьюнити. Бонусом на ресурсе можно почитать полезные статьи, ознакомиться с рейтингами и посмотреть, как себя презентуют другие специалисты.
Geekjob
Этот ресурс интересен тем, что здесь можно искать работу анонимно — когда потенциальный работодатель находит вас сам. Это полезно и в том случае, если вы хотите оградиться от назойливых или нерелевантных предложений о работе: например, где искать работу программисту с большим опытом, чтобы его не преследовали рекрутеры? Geekjob прекрасно подойдет для этой задачи.
SuperJob
Ресурс с удобными фильтрами по зарплате, графику и отраслям. Если вам важно увеличить охват вашего резюме, выложите его здесь помимо других сайтов.
Работа.ру
Еще один простой и удобный агрегатор вакансий. Чтобы повысить шансы на просмотр, пишите сопроводительные письма для компаний, а резюме делайте лаконичным и информативным.
БУДУ
Сервис поиска работы в IT и не только. Удобная навигация: разделе «Компании» можно подробнее узнать о работодателях и отфильтровать нужные вакансии. А еще БУДУ ведет телеграм-канал с полезными советами и подборками какансий.
Соцсети
Кажется, что искать вакансии соцсетях — несерьезно, не лучше ли обратиться к серьезным агрегаторам, где можно искать работу, не отвлекаясь на посты и сообщения? Не совсем так: использовать социальные сети для трудоустройства IT — удобно, а еще это дает преимущества, недоступные на сайтах.
Широкий выбор вакансий: социальные сети сегодня предоставляют доступ к колоссальному количеству вакансий. Вы можете найти предложения как от крупных мировых компаний и стартапов, так и небольшие фриланс-проекты. Такой выбор позволит найти работу, которая соответствует вашим интересам и навыкам.
Прямое общение с работодателями: социальные сети позволят вам легко связаться с потенциальными работодателями. Вы можете отправлять сообщения и задать вопросы сразу — это делает процесс поиска работы эффективнее.
Актуальная информация: в соцсетях вы всегда можете получить актуальную информацию как в целом о рынке труда в IT-сфере, так и о конкретной компании. Вы всегда будете в курсе последних трендов, новых вакансий и изменений в сфере технологий.
Сообщество и поддержка: во многих соцсетях есть группы и комьюнити, где вы можете общаться с другими IT-специалистами, делиться опытом и получать советы по поиску работы. Это позволит получать полезный опыт и чувствовать принадлежность к общей цели.
Легкое обновление профиля: в социальных сетях можно без труда поддерживать актуальность своего профиля — добавлять новые навыки и проекты, делиться достижениями. Это сделает вас более привлекательными для потенциальных работодателей.
А еще поиск работы в соцсетях — это гибкость и удобство, так как вы можете редактировать резюме, откликаться на вакансии и переписываться с эйчарами в любое время и с любого устройства. В каких соцсетях лучше искать работу?
LinkedIn — платформа, которую невероятно ценят HR-специалисты в IT. Если вы думаете, где искать работу программистом, создание профиля на LinkedIn становится просто обязательным шагом. Не забывайте регулярно обновлять свой блог, писать на актуальные темы, добавлять в друзья потенциальных коллег и эйчаров, комментировать посты и общаться.
В Telegram есть множество тематических каналов, посвященных IT-вакансиям. Вы можете выбрать каналы, которые соответствуют вашим интересам и экспертизе, чтобы видеть только релевантные предложения. Вот несколько каналов с вакансиями, на которые можно подписаться:
IT Вакансии {Разработка | QA | DevOps | Management}
Telegram IT Job
Remote IT (Inflow)
Job for Frontend (JavaScript + Node.js) developers
Вакансии и Стажировки от MyResume
Devops Jobs — вакансии и резюме
Работа в геймдеве (вакансии)
PHP — вакансии, поиск работы и аналитика
QA — вакансии
Jobs Code: IT вакансии
Работа в ИТ
Dart Jobs
Вакансии Backend/Frontend
JavaScript Jobs — вакансии и резюме
Mobile Dev Jobs — вакансии и аналитика
Job for Junior
Работа для программистов
В какой соцсети вы бы ни искали работу, всегда проверяйте достоверность работодателей и вакансий, прежде чем отправлять свое резюме или личные данные.
Где можно искать работу за рубежом
Ожидается, что к концу 2023 года глобальные расходы на IT во всем мире увеличатся примерно на 4,66 трлн долларов, а значит, вырастет и число рабочих мест. Так что сейчас лучшее время, чтобы искать работу за границей. Приведем несколько ресурсов, которые вам в этом помогут.
Glassdoor предоставляет информацию о зарплатах, отзывы о компаниях и список актуальных вакансий. Также здесь можно читать интервью с сотрудниками компаний.
Indeed является крупнейшим поисковиком вакансий в мире.
Monster — это еще один крупный ресурс для поиска работы, который позволяет создавать профили, загружать резюме и искать вакансии по разным критериям.
Dice — это специализированный ресурс для поиска работы в IT и технологических областях. Здесь можно найти множество вакансий и информацию о рынке труда.
AngelList: — это платформа, специализирующаяся на стартапах и венчурных инвестициях. Здесь можно найти вакансии в технологических стартапах.
Kaggle Jobs — если вы занимаетесь искусственным интеллектом или машинным обучением, вы можете искать вакансии на Kaggle Jobs.
Кстати, крупные российские рекрутинговые платформы, такие как Headhunter и SuperJob, также ориентированы на другие регионы. Многие компании, особенно крупные международные корпорации, ищут специалистов и сотрудников не только внутри страны, но и за ее пределами. Это делает их удобными для поиска работы как на местном, так и на международном рынке труда.
Где искать работу на фрилансе
Фриланс — это не только картинка из интернета, где сотрудник сидит на пляже с ноутбуком. Порой это может быть труднее офисной рутины — нужно уметь рассчитывать свое время, общаться напрямую с заказчиками и быть готовыми работать даже в выходные. Чтобы не разочароваться в формате такой работы, протестируйте ее на коротком промежутке времени. Приведем несколько фриланс-площадок, где можно найти задачи по душе.
Programmer Meet Designer
Workzilla
UpWork
People Per Hour
Guru
IFreelance
Weblancer.net
Freelance.ru
FL.ru
Freelancehunt.com
FreelanceJob.ru
Чтобы выбрать фриланс-ресурс, который вам подойдет, ознакомьтесь с обзорами и отзывами на него и подробно изучите условия каждой площадки.
Что в итоге?
Ответы на вопрос «на каких сайтах и где искать работу» настолько разнообразны, что каждый может найти оптимальный путь к своей идеальной карьере. От мировых лидеров в сфере найма до уютных локальных комьюнити в социальных сетях, от зарубежных работодателей до работы внутри России — IT раскрывает все дороги к успеху. Помните, что при выборе площадки для поиска работы важно учитывать свои цели, интересы и амбиции, и использовать все возможности на максимум.
GLBP (Gateway load Balancing Protocol) - это протокол, разработанный компанией Cisco, который обеспечивает распределение нагрузки на несколько роутеров, используя всего 1 виртуальный адрес.
Этот протокол входит в группу FHRP, а теперь давайте напомню какие протоколы в неё входят.
HSRP (Hot Standby Router Protocol) - проприетарный протокол, разработанный Cisco;
VRRP (Virtual Router Redundancy Protocol) - свободный протокол, сделан на основе HSRP;
GLBP (Gateway Load Balancing Protocol).
GLBP обеспечивает балансировку трафика одновременно на несколько роутеров, когда HSRP и VRRP работал только один из 2х роутеров.
Терминология протокола
AVG (Active Virtual Gateway) - активный роутер, который занимается раздачей MAC адресов устройствам. Некий начальник над роутерами в сети GLBP .
Это роль диспетчера, который указывает устройствам, как распределять трафик по средству раздачи им MAC адресов, когда приходит ARP запрос. То есть IP адрес у всех будет единый, а вот MAC адреса будут разные.
AVF (Active Virtual Forwarder) - активный роутер, который пропускает через себя трафик.
Роутер с ролью AVG только один может быть, а вот с ролью AVF любой, при этом AVG может быть и AVF одновременно.
Настройка этого протокола такая же, как и любого протокола группы FHRP на интерфейсе (в данном случает interface e0/0)
Теперь пройдемся по командам
Router(config-if)# glbp 1 ip 192.168.0.254 //включение GLBP
Router(config-if)# glbp 1 priority 110 //установка приоритета 110 (если приоритет будет выше остальных ,то он станет AVG по умолчанию 100)
Router(config-if)# glbp 1 preempt //установит режим приемптинга для AVG ( работает также как и в HSRP, VRRP)
Router(config-if)# glbp 1 weighting 115 //установить вес для AVF в 115 Router(config-if)# glbp 1 load-balancing host-depended | round-robin | weighted
Для чего требуется вес?
Для того, чтобы выбрать кто будет AVF. Чтобы при падении линка до провайдера мы могли передать эту роль кому-нибудь ещё. Далее рассмотрим механизм передачи:
Router(config-if)# glbp 1 weighting 130 lower 20 upper 129
Команда установит вес для Forwarder в 130, а нижняя граница будет 20, верхняя 129. Если вес упадет до 19, то он перестанет быть AVF, а если вес возрастет выше 129 после падения, то он снова превратиться в AVF. По умолчанию lower равен 1, upper равен 100.
Данная команда используется совместно с Track:
Router(config)# track 1 interface e0/1 line-protocol
Router(config)# int e0/0
Router(config-if)# glbp 1 weighting track 1 decrement 111
Как проверить стал ли роутер AVG?
R2(config)#do show glbp
Ethernet0/0 - Group 1
State is Active
...
Смотрим, состояние Active, а это значит он и стал AVG. Взглянем на второй:
R3(config-if)#do sh glbp
Ethernet0/0 - Group 1
State is Standby
...
Говорит о том, что он не стал AVG.
При просмотре команды нужно обращать внимание на State is Active / Listen / Standby. Где AVG это Active, запасной Standby, а тот, кто в выборах не участвует Listen. То есть если роутер State is Active накроется, то его место займет маршрутизатор с состоянием State is Standby. При этом каждый роутер является AVF.
3 режима AVG
Round Robin (по кругу) - это значит, что балансирует равномерно, раздавая каждому устройству новый MAC по списку, а как заканчивается список, начинает заново. Когда в сети просыпается устройство или ARP table устаревает, то у него нет mac шлюза по умолчанию. Он формирует ARP запрос, где запрашивает эти данные. Отвечает ему только AVG, который выдает виртуальные mac адреса за роутеры в группе glbp. Одному ПК он выдаст свой ,потому что он еще и AVF , следующему ПК - R3 mac-address выдаст ,следующему устройству R4 mac-address .
Weighted (утяжеленный) - когда AVF имеет больший вес, то принимает большую нагрузку, чем остальные роутеры.
Host dependent (Зависимое устройство) - присваивает постоянный MAC определенным устройствам. Допустим к нему обратился VPC10 за MAC адресом и AVG выдает его, а также запоминает, что ему выдает только этот адрес.
Как это работает? Представим, что в нашей топологии:
Роутер R3 (State is Listen) умрет, то тогда его клиентов возьмет любой из группы, либо R2, либо R4.
Роутер R2 (State is Active) умрет, то тогда роль AVG займет роутер R4 (State is Standby), а также возьмет его клиентов (или распределит между R3/R4). R3 станет запасным AVG.
Роутер R4 (State is Standby) умрет, то его клиентов возьмет один из R2/R3 и R3 (State is Listen) станет State is Standby.
show glbp на разных роутерах
R2(config-if)#do sh glbp
Ethernet0/0 - Group 1
State is Active
1 state change, last state change 00:06:48
Virtual IP address is 192.168.0.254
Hello time 3 sec, hold time 10 sec
Next hello sent in 2.176 secs
Redirect time 600 sec, forwarder timeout 14400 sec
Preemption disabled
Active is local
Standby is 192.168.0.3, priority 100 (expires in 8.576 sec)
Priority 100 (default)
Weighting 100 (default 100), thresholds: lower 1, upper 100
Load balancing: round-robin
Group members:
aabb.cc00.2000 (192.168.0.1) local
aabb.cc00.3000 (192.168.0.2)
aabb.cc00.4000 (192.168.0.3)
There are 3 forwarders (1 active)
Forwarder 1
State is Active
1 state change, last state change 00:06:37
MAC address is 0007.b400.0101 (default)
Owner ID is aabb.cc00.2000
Redirection enabled
Preemption enabled, min delay 30 sec
Active is local, weighting 100
Forwarder 2
State is Listen
MAC address is 0007.b400.0102 (learnt)
Owner ID is aabb.cc00.3000
Redirection enabled, 599.104 sec remaining (maximum 600 sec)
Time to live: 14399.104 sec (maximum 14400 sec)
Preemption enabled, min delay 30 sec
Active is 192.168.0.2 (primary), weighting 100 (expires in 9.216 sec)
Forwarder 3
State is Listen
MAC address is 0007.b400.0103 (learnt)
Owner ID is aabb.cc00.4000
Redirection enabled, 598.592 sec remaining (maximum 600 sec)
Time to live: 14398.592 sec (maximum 14400 sec)
Preemption enabled, min delay 30 sec
Active is 192.168.0.3 (primary), weighting 100 (expires in 10.016 sec)
В данный момент я подключил 3 роутера в группу glbp 1 и если посмотреть на вывод, то он показывает отношение 1 роутера к другому. То есть R2 по отношению к R3 и R4 является active, а остальные listen . Если глянуть на R3 и R4 ,то картина будет с точностью наоборот. Это сделано для того, чтобы наблюдать, какой роутер взял на себя роль AVF в случае падения, тогда при падении один из Forwarder будет в состоянии Active.
Режим preempt
Этот режим, как и в других протоколах типа FHRP помогает роутеру настроить нужную роль. В GLBP это будет касаться AVG и AVF. Для AVG по умолчанию он отключен, а для AVF по умолчанию включен, с задержкой 30 секунд.
preempt для AVG:
R2(config)# int e0/0
R2(config-if)# glbp 1 preempt
preempt для AVF:
R2(config)# int e0/0
R2(config-if)# glbp 1 forwarder preempt delay minimum 60
Настройка таймеров
Настройка интервалов в группе GLBP:
R2(config-if)# glbp 1 timers 3 10
Настройка пароля
//Аутентификация через md5 по хешу
R2(config-if)#glbp 1 authentication md5 key-string CISCO
//Аутентификация в открытом виде
R2(config-if)#glbp 1 authentication text CISCO
Диагностика
R2# show glbp //показать общую информацию по протоколу группы FHRP
R2# show glbp brief //показывает краткую таблицу по всем роутерам группы GLBP
----------------------------------------------------------------------------------------------------------------------------
R2#show glbp brief
Interface Grp Fwd Pri State Address Active router Standby router
Et0/0 1 - 110 Standby 192.168.0.254 192.168.0.4 local
Et0/0 1 1 - Active 0007.b400.0101 local -
Et0/0 1 2 - Listen 0007.b400.0102 192.168.0.2 -
Et0/0 1 3 - Listen 0007.b400.0103 192.168.0.3 -
Et0/0 1 4 - Listen 0007.b400.0104 192.168.0.4 -
Важное
В топологии GLBP может пропускать максимум 4 роутера, если подключить 5, то он попадет в таблицу GLBP, но пропускать через себя трафик не станет. А будет просто ждать, пока умрет какой-либо AVF.